OUR PROCESS

Scope, LOTO & Planning

Our demolition experts document all machinery assets, weights, dimensions, and removal paths. We coordinate lockout/tagout (LOTO) procedures and fluid drain-down with your maintenance and EHS teams to ensure total safety before work begins.

Protection & Controls

We install floor protection systems, barricades, and public access controls. For enclosed environments, our demolition contractors in NJ prepare hot-work permits, ventilation systems, and fire watch protocols to ensure compliance and safety.

Disconnect, Dismantle & Rig

All utilities are isolated before disassembly. Machinery is dismantled into manageable sections and rigged using skates, forklifts, gantries, or cranes. OEM guidelines are followed where required to protect sensitive components.

Load-Out & Closeout

Removed equipment is loaded for transport or routed through recycling under our green demolitions NJ program. Work areas are broom-clean and fully operational for your next phase. Asset logs and serial documentation are provided upon request.
